  THERMOSOLUTAL CONVECTION HEAT AND MASS TRANSFER IN A VERTICAL ANNULAR ENCLOSURE
 
 
Title: THERMOSOLUTAL CONVECTION HEAT AND MASS TRANSFER IN A VERTICAL ANNULAR ENCLOSURE
Author: Wang, L. W.
Wei, C Y.
Appeared in: Experimental heat transfer
Paging: Volume 5 (1992) nr. 4 pages 315-328
Year: 1992-10-01
Contents: The purpose of the present study is to investigate flows resulting from buoyancy forces due to a combination of temperature and species concentration effects in a vertical annular enclosure. An electrochemical system is described that enables opposing temperature and concentration gradients to be imposed. Complex flow patterns are observed as the parameters are varied.
